Terex Corp. is a global industrial equipment manufacturer, specializing in materials processing machinery, waste and recycling solutions, mobile elevating work platforms (MEWP), and equipment for the electric utility industry. The company is headquartered in Norwalk, Connecticut and currently employs 10,700 full-time employees. Its segments include Environmental Solutions (ES), Material Processing (MP) and Aerials.
